Teton County Search & Rescue Foundation

Organization Overview

Teton County Search & Rescue Foundation is located in Jackson, WY. The organization was established in 2014. According to its NTEE Classification (M23) the organization is classified as: Search & Rescue Squads, under the broad grouping of Public Safety, Disaster Preparedness & Relief and related organizations. As of 06/2021, Teton County Search & Rescue Foundation employed 4 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Teton County Search & Rescue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 06/2021, Teton County Search & Rescue Foundation generated $1.3m in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 7 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 16.4% each year . All expenses for the organization totaled $776.9k during the year ending 06/2021. While expenses have increased by 7.7% per year over the past 7 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

THE TETON COUNTY SEARCH & RESCUE FOUNDATION PROVIDES DIRECT SUPPORT, COMMUNITY EDUCATION, AND ADVOCACY FOR THE BENEFIT OF THE TETON COUNTY SEARCH AND RESCUE VOLUNTEERS.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

SUPPORT OF TETON COUNTY SHERIFF'S OFFICE SEARCH AND RESCUE VOLUNTEERS INCLUDING OVER 4000 HOURS OF SPECIALIZED TRAINING AND EDUCATION EQUIPMENT FOR 38 VOLUNTEERS.


COMMUNITY AWARENESS, ADVOCACY AND EDUCATION PROGRAMS GEARED TOWARD SAFETY IN THE OUTDOORS, INCLUDING COMMUNITY EDUCATION CLASSES PROVIDING INSTRUCTION AND PREVENTION TECHNIQUES FOR OVER 2,500 COMMUNITY MEMBERS.
